Best Wishes For My Sister

This is a little birthday wish  I'm sending out your way. I hope you have a happy one, 'cause it's your special day. This is what I have to write and send to you with love. You are a very special sis  whom I think highly of. The year of your birth was '66 we stayed nearly side by side. I took you for our daily strolls with lots and lots of pride. No matter what the weather was no one ever tried to stop us. You often glared with great excitement  as you watched me step from the bus. I can't believe it's been so long,  since I held you in my arms. You were a darling baby sister to me   One I loved to protect from great harms. The years passed hurriedly by And we each went separate ways. I often think of the fun we had during those childhood days. We have now entered the true adult life with marriages and babies of our own. Soon after baby Sarah was born  I helped you during her first week home. I took this time away from my job, at Signet where I was employed. I cuddled her closely to my chest  with reminiscences of times enjoyed. The precious moments that I remember we have spent together in the past. I retain the love that we both shared  and this love will always last. There's a bond holding us together that's held us close from the start. Happy Birthday wishes to my dearest Lil flowing out from the depth of my heart. Here's wishing you joy and pleasure throughout thirty five more years. By then our hair will be silver or gray, and both having some senior fears. I Love You!
